Abstract

The distinguishing characteristics of the definitions of health promotion and health education are here examined. Two different planning frameworks, the PRECEDE-PROCEDE and the HELPSAM models are introduced. Solutions can be directed in two major directions are discussed: individual changes and organizational changes. It is therefore, important for specialists to have an in- depth knowledge of the areas of viable intervention and to understand their functions and role in public health practice.
